Senior Software Engineer – Developer Environment Tooling

1 month ago


Cambridge, United Kingdom arm limited Full time

The Role

Job Overview

In the Developer Platforms group at Arm, our mission is to make software development on the Arm architecture simple and intuitive. We are growing our IDE team and are looking for a passionate software engineer to help us create frictionless developer experiences.

Our team tackles a diverse set of developer challenges, delivering tools that support toolchain setup and configuration, intellisense, debug and analysis, and device virtualisation.

This is a unique opportunity to work on many different technologies in a group delivering tools across multiple platforms including desktop and browser.

The ideal candidate for this role will have engineering experience across different technologies and have a passion to build developer tools in the Arm ecosystem.

Responsibilities

You will join an experienced team working with cutting edge technologies in an agile environment which requires proactivity, dynamic approaches to problem solving and creative thinking.

Work as part of a diverse team to design, deliver and support the tools and experiences required to support development on Arm processors Demonstrate quality through unit testing and continuous integration Work alongside peers and junior team members to tackle technical problems, mentoring as necessary Form effective relationships with other engineers, product managers and UX specialists to enable collaboration and best understand and empower our users. Engage with our agile planning and development processes to help shape delivery of our products

Required Skills and Experience

We are seeking an experienced engineer with the following skills:

Experience working with IDE extensions and plugins for environments such as Visual Studio, Visual Studio Code, Theia, Eclipse, (Neo)Vim or JetBrains Familiarity with the basics of modern, effective software development: source control, automated testing, object-oriented or functional paradigms and the Agile methodology. A "get things done" attitude to shipping high-quality, robust software which is maintainable and responsive to evolving requirements. A passion to push forward the state of the art in developer tooling by embracing new technologies and continuous innovation

"Nice to Have" Skills and Experience:

Any experience with the technologies listed below is beneficial, however, a desire to learn is far more valuable than experience in any tool, and we actively support ongoing training.

TypeScript (browser, server, and client) - , Electron, React, Visual Studio Code extensions Machine learning and generative AI Language Server Protocol (LSP) and Debug Adapter Protocol (DAP) Development for IoT devices, Cortex-A or Cortex-M Arm hardware C/C++ - debuggers and USB protocols (especially pertaining to embedded devices) Continuous integration workflows including build systems, testing and deployment Source control systems and continuous integration & delivery, especially GitHub Experience with Agile & UX design principles and processes

Please provide a covering letter on application.

In return:

Arm is a global, diverse organisation of dedicated, innovative, and highly capable people. We believe great ideas come from a vibrant and inclusive workplace where everyone can grow, succeed, and share their outstanding contributions

We are an Equal Opportunity Employer and do not discriminate in any way against any employee or applicant for employment.

#



  • Cambridge, United Kingdom ARM Full time

    Job OverviewIn the Developer Platforms group at Arm, our mission is to make software development on the Arm architecture simple and intuitive. We are growing our IDE team and are looking for a passionate software engineer to help us create frictionless developer experiences. Our team tackles a diverse set of developer challenges, delivering tools that...


  • Cambridge, United Kingdom ARM Full time

    Job OverviewIn the Developer Platforms group at Arm, our mission is to make software development on the Arm architecture simple and intuitive. We are growing our IDE team and are looking for a passionate software engineer to help us create frictionless developer experiences. Our team tackles a diverse set of developer challenges, delivering tools that...

  • Senior Tools Engineer

    2 weeks ago


    Cambridge, United Kingdom LANGHAM RECRUITMENT LIMITED Full time

    **Senior Tools Engineer| Up to £70K | Fully Remote | Games Studio** Do you want to work for one of the UK’s Leading Games Studios? Want to join a company who are passionate about building the most engaging gaming experiences for players all around the world? Then this could be the role for you. We are looking for a Senior Tools Engineer to join the team,...


  • Cambridge, Cambridgeshire, United Kingdom Cloud Software Group Full time

    You understand software development principles and apply those to craft code that's easy to understand, modify, and test. You also understand quality, resiliency and supportability. If you're a self-motivated developer who enjoys taking ownership and making a tangible impact, we want to hear from you Our team: The StoreFront Services team, based in...


  • Cambridge, United Kingdom Cloud Software Group Full time

    You understand software development principles and apply those to craft code that's easy to understand, modify, and test. You also understand quality, resiliency and supportability. If you're a self-motivated developer who enjoys taking ownership and making a tangible impact, we want to hear from you! Our team:  The StoreFront Services team, based in...


  • Cambridge, United Kingdom LANGHAM RECRUITMENT LIMITED Full time

    **Senior Web Tools Engineer| Up to £60K | Fully Remote | Games Studio** Do you want to work for one of the UK’s Leading Games Studios? Want to join a company who are passionate about building the most engaging gaming experiences for players all around the world? Then this could be the role for you. We are looking for a Senior Tools Engineer to join the...


  • Cambridge, United Kingdom InterSTEM Full time

    Senior Software Engineer at a Market Research InnovatorCambridge - Hybrid - 3 days per weekInterSTEM Recruitment is proud to partner with a leading player in the market research domain, a company renowned for its innovative approach and commitment to developing proprietary solutions. We're seeking a Senior Software Engineer with a passion for cloud...


  • Cambridge, United Kingdom InterSTEM Full time

    Senior Software Engineer at a Market Research Innovator Cambridge - Hybrid - 3 days per week InterSTEM Recruitment is proud to partner with a leading player in the market research domain, a company renowned for its innovative approach and commitment to developing proprietary solutions. We're seeking a Senior Software Engineer with a passion for cloud...


  • Cambridge, United Kingdom InterSTEM Full time

    Job DescriptionSenior Software Engineer at a Market Research InnovatorCambridge - Hybrid - 3 days per weekInterSTEM Recruitment is proud to partner with a leading player in the market research domain, a company renowned for its innovative approach and commitment to developing proprietary solutions. We're seeking a Senior Software Engineer with a passion for...


  • Cambridge, United Kingdom InterSTEM Full time

    Senior Software Engineer at a Market Research InnovatorCambridge - Hybrid - 3 days per weekInterSTEM Recruitment is proud to partner with a leading player in the market research domain, a company renowned for its innovative approach and commitment to developing proprietary solutions. We're seeking a Senior Software Engineer with a passion for cloud...


  • Cambridge, United Kingdom InterSTEM Full time

    Senior Software Engineer at a Market Research InnovatorCambridge - Hybrid - 3 days per weekInterSTEM Recruitment is proud to partner with a leading player in the market research domain, a company renowned for its innovative approach and commitment to developing proprietary solutions. We're seeking a Senior Software Engineer with a passion for cloud...


  • Cambridge, United Kingdom InterSTEM Full time

    Senior Software Engineer at a Market Research InnovatorCambridge - Hybrid - 3 days per weekInterSTEM Recruitment is proud to partner with a leading player in the market research domain, a company renowned for its innovative approach and commitment to developing proprietary solutions. We're seeking a Senior Software Engineer with a passion for cloud...


  • Cambridge, United Kingdom InterSTEM Full time

    Senior Software Engineer at a Market Research InnovatorCambridge - Hybrid - 3 days per weekSubmit your CV and any additional required information after you have read this description by clicking on the application button.InterSTEM Recruitment is proud to partner with a leading player in the market research domain, a company renowned for its innovative...


  • Cambridge, United Kingdom Siemens Digital Industries Software Full time

    **We are Siemens** Siemens Digital Industries Software is a leading provider of solutions for the design, simulation and manufacture of products across many different industries. Formula 1 cars, skyscrapers, ships, space exploration vehicles, and many of the objects we see in our daily lives are being conceived and manufactured using our Product Lifecycle...


  • Cambridge, Cambridgeshire, United Kingdom Skillsearch Full time

    Job Title: Senior Software Engineer at CambridgeAre you a software developer with experience and on the lookout for a fresh opportunity in Cambridge? Our client is currently in need of a Senior Software Engineer to join their team on a full-time basis, offering an enticing salary and benefits package.As a Senior Software Engineer in this role, you will play...

  • Software Engineer

    2 weeks ago


    Cambridge, United Kingdom InterSTEM Full time

    Senior Software Engineer at a Market Research InnovatornCambridge - Hybrid - 3 days per weekInterSTEM Recruitment is proud to partner with a leading player in the market research domain, a company renowned for its innovative approach and commitment to developing proprietary solutions. We're seeking a Senior Software Engineer with a passion for cloud...

  • Software Engineer

    4 weeks ago


    Cambridge, United Kingdom InterSTEM Full time

    Senior Software Engineer at a Market Research InnovatornCambridge - Hybrid - 3 days per weekInterSTEM Recruitment is proud to partner with a leading player in the market research domain, a company renowned for its innovative approach and commitment to developing proprietary solutions. We're seeking a Senior Software Engineer with a passion for cloud...

  • Software Engineer

    3 days ago


    Cambridge, Cambridgeshire, United Kingdom InterSTEM Full time

    Senior Software Engineer at a Market Research Innovator Cambridge - Hybrid - 3 days per week InterSTEM Recruitment is proud to partner with a leading player in the market research domain, a company renowned for its innovative approach and commitment to developing proprietary solutions. We're seeking a Senior Software Engineer with a passion for cloud...


  • Cambridge, Cambridgeshire, United Kingdom InterSTEM Full time

    Senior Software Engineer at a Market Research Innovator Cambridge - Hybrid - 3 days per week InterSTEM Recruitment is proud to partner with a leading player in the market research domain, a company renowned for its innovative approach and commitment to developing proprietary solutions. We're seeking a Senior Software Engineer with a passion for cloud...


  • Cambridge, Cambridgeshire, United Kingdom InterSTEM Full time

    Senior Software Engineer at a Market Research Innovator Cambridge - Hybrid - 3 days per week InterSTEM Recruitment is proud to partner with a leading player in the market research domain, a company renowned for its innovative approach and commitment to developing proprietary solutions. We're seeking a Senior Software Engineer with a passion for cloud...